How online approaches and practical techniques help
Many effective therapy methods use clear steps people can try between sessions. Cristin emphasizes evidence-based techniques that break problems into manageable pieces and teach practical skills for anxiety and stress. For example, behavioral strategies focus on changing what you do day to day to reduce worry and avoidance and can help with panic attacks and social anxiety. Cognitive techniques look at unhelpful thinking patterns and offer simple tools to test and reframe thoughts that fuel anxiety and low self esteem.Finding the right approach is a collaborative process. Cristin will work with each person to choose methods that match their goals, needs, and comfort level. Together they set short-term goals, try techniques in session, and adjust the plan based on what helps most.
Online sessions let people access therapy in different ways. Video calls are useful for face-to-face conversation and role play. Phone sessions can be a good option when bandwidth is limited or when someone prefers not to use video. Live chat and text-based messaging support shorter check-ins, quick coping reminders, and ongoing accountability between longer sessions. These options aim to make therapy more flexible and easier to fit into busy family life or work schedules.
